How to Drink Recovery Electrolyte with D3K2 After Workout

Recovery Electrolyte with D3K2 is best used after training by matching the serving to sweat loss, mixing it with an appropriate amount of water, and drinking it within the early recovery window rather than randomly hours later. For most post-workout situations, one serving in roughly 400–700 mL of water works as a practical starting point, while heavier sweat loss may require more fluid and sometimes more than one serving over time.
Potassium in Recovery Electrolytes: Benefits, Dose & Safety

Potassium in a recovery electrolyte helps support intracellular fluid balance, muscle function, nerve signaling, and the sodium–potassium system that keeps cells working under physical stress. It does not replace sodium’s role in sweat replacement, but it helps complete the hydration picture—especially in formulas designed for training recovery, repeated sweating, and more balanced electrolyte support.
Electrolyte Powder Ingredients: What Matters Most?

Electrolyte powders typically contain sodium, chloride, potassium, magnesium, and sometimes calcium, plus supporting ingredients like citric acid, flavoring, and sweeteners. The most important ingredients for real-world hydration are usually sodium + chloride (fluid retention), potassium (cellular balance), and magnesium (muscle/nerve function). “Best” depends on sweat loss, diet, and tolerance, not hype.
